COMMUNICATIONS The following was received: Dept. of Natural Resources Division of Geological & Geophysical Surveys Annual Report 2008 (as required by AS 41.08.030) REPORTS OF STANDING COMMITTEES HB 2 The Judiciary Committee considered: HOUSE BILL NO. 2 "An Act relating to the issuance of a certificate of birth resulting in a stillbirth." and recommends it be replaced with: CS FOR HOUSE BILL NO. 2(HSS) (same title) The report was signed by Representative Ramras, Chair, with the following individual recommendations: Do pass (5): Lynn, Coghill, Gatto, Dahlstrom, Ramras The following fiscal note(s) apply to CSHB 2(HSS): 1. Zero, Dept. of Health & Social Services HB 2 was referred to the Rules Committee for placement on the calendar. 2009-03-16 House Journal Page 0483 HB 35 The Judiciary Committee considered: HOUSE BILL NO. 35 "An Act relating to notice and consent for a minor's abortion; relating to penalties for performing an abortion; relating to a judicial bypass procedure for an abortion; relating to coercion of a minor to have an abortion; relating to reporting of abortions performed on minors; amending Rule 220, Alaska Rules of Appellate Procedure, and Rule 20, Alaska Probate Rules, relating to judicial bypass for an abortion; and providing for an effective date." The report was signed by Representative Ramras, Chair, with the following individual recommendations: Do pass (5): Lynn, Coghill, Gatto, Dahlstrom, Ramras Do not pass (2): Gruenberg, Holmes The following fiscal note(s) apply: 1. Zero, Dept. of Law 2. Indeterminate, Dept. of Health & Social Services HB 35 was referred to the Finance Committee.
